Oudesová Barbora
Barbora Oudesová is a Prague-based designer and painter. She holds a master’s degree in Design from the prestigious French art school ESAD (École Supérieure d’Art et de Design), where she had the opportunity to develop her perception of form, material, and visual aesthetics within an international context. *1989, Strakonice, Czech Republic
Education:
2014 – 2016 École supérieure d'art et de design d'Orléans, FR
2010 – 2013 University of West Bohemia, Ladislav Sutnar Faculty of Art and Design, CZ

About: Barbora Oudesová is a designer and painter based in Prague. Working in acrylics, she uses food as a metaphor for memory, identity, and life's ceremonies — painting seafood, shared meals, and the rituals around the table that stay with us long after they are gone. Her still lifes are quiet meditations on what we long for, what we value, and what we leave behind.
